I would second Capetown. We were there last year, although we stayed in Stellenbosch (check out Sugarbird Manor). Had a great time - went wine tasting, checked out some beaches, hit South Cape and had a great evening at the V&A. Long flight, but combine it with some other activities and it is so worth it.

3rd for Cape Town. This incredibly small area is home to its own plant and animal kingdoms.... life you don't see elsewhere on Earth. Plus Table Mountain is one of a kind. Epic.

When you get to 50yrs old you spend more and more of your own dime to check mark the bucket listers: Booked for Antarctic cruise next December for the Total Solar Eclipse. Goal is to touch 'em all!

All that being said, Greek Islands - fantastic place to spend someone else's money.
